"Modern Copper Smelting" by Donald M. Levy is a scientific publication written in the early 20th century. This work compiles lectures aimed at senior students in metallurgy, discussing the principles and practices of modern copper smelting, enriched with historical context, applications, and the properties of copper. The text is illustrated with images and diagrams to support the detailed explanations of various smelting processes and techniques. At the start of the book, the author introduces the significance and historical development of copper, emphasizing its importance since antiquity. He outlines how the copper industry evolved alongside technological advancements, including the introduction of steam engines and the development of smelting practices across different regions. The opening section sets the stage for a deeper exploration of the complexities of copper smelting, detailing the industry’s statistics, methods, and materials that will be elaborated upon in subsequent chapters.
